The Château de Meung-sur-Loire is a historic castle and former episcopal palace nestled in the charming town of Meung-sur-Loire, in the Loiret department of France. Situated along the scenic Loire River, approximately 17 kilometers west of Orléans, this impressive structure stands at an elevation of 106 meters and is a notable highlight among the renowned Loire Valley castles.     Built from the 12th to the 18th century, the castle of Meung-sur-Loire served as a residence for the bishops of Orléans, then as a prison.
    This castle and its underground passages can be visited from 10 a.m. to 7 p.m. in July/August and from 10 a.m. to 6 p.m. from the end of May to October.

    What historical figures are associated with Château de Meung-sur-Loire?

    The castle has a rich history, serving for centuries as the country residence of the Bishops of Orléans. It welcomed significant figures such as kings François I, Charles VII, and Louis XI. Notably, it held strategic importance during the Hundred Years' War and was liberated by Joan of Arc in 1429. The celebrated poet François Villon was also famously imprisoned here.

    What makes the architecture of Château de Meung-sur-Loire unique?

    The Château de Meung-sur-Loire is famously known as the 'château aux deux visages' (castle with two faces) due to its remarkable architectural duality. One facade, facing the town, retains an imposing medieval appearance from the 13th century with formidable towers. In contrast, the facade overlooking the gardens presents a classical 18th-century style, notable for its distinctive color, giving it an air reminiscent of Versailles. It is considered one of the rare painted castles in France.
